Xsd Anyattribute, The xs:anyAttribute element indicates that the resulting XML document can contain any attributes.
Xsd Anyattribute, Nov 28, 2013 · Essentially, <xs:anyAttribute> has a processContents attribute, and the default value is strict, which means you are allowed any attribute you like provided that there is a matching attribute declaration in the schema. There is a piece of XML schema from family. May 1, 2008 · Optional. See more info at May 1, 2008 · Optional. It shows a declaration for the "person" element. Element and Attribute Groups The <any> Element The <anyAttribute> Element In the Schema Instance namespace, XML Schema defines an attribute called schemaLocation which may be applied to any element in an XML document. In essence this is a wild card, allowing any element to contain any undefined attributes. Figure: The xs:anyAttribute Component Enables the author to extend the XML document with attributes not specified by the schema. There are further restrictions that can be placed on the attributes that can appear in the XML document (See properties). <anyAttribute> element The <anyAttribute> element enables us to extend the XML document with attributes not specified by the schema! The following example is a fragment from an XML schema named "family. The xs:anyAttribute element indicates that the resulting XML document can contain any attributes. xsd". XML processors are allowed to ignore namespaces they can't understand, but schemaLocation allows a document author to specify the location of the schema associated with a namespace. Element xsd:anyAttribute: Element information Namespace: http://www. Sep 24, 2014 · XML Schema cannot specify that a document is valid regardless of its content. The following example is a fragment from an XML schema called "family. xsd that shows a declaration for the "person" element. Toolbox Icon Access To display the ' XSD anyAttribute Properties' dialog for the selected «XSDany» stereotyped UML attribute, use one of the methods outlined here. However, if you're able to specify the root element, you can use xs:anyAttribute and xs:any to allow any attributes on the root element and any XML under the root: Definition and Usage The anyAttribute element enables the author to extend the XML document with attributes not specified by the schema. w3. Element Information Parent elements: complexType, restriction (both simpleContent and complexContent), extension (both simpleContent and complexContent), attributeGroup Syntax May 1, 2008 · Optional. org/2001/XMLSchema Schema document: XMLSchema. The <anyAttribute> Element Consider the following example. By using the <anyAttribute> element we can add any number of attributes to the "person" element: The xs:anyAttribute element indicates that the resulting XML document can contain any attributes. note <any> and <anyAttribute> elements are used to make extensible documents! They allow documents to contain additional elements that are not declared in the main XML schema. If processContents is specified, it must one of the following. processContents An indicator of how an application or XML processor should handle validation of XML documents against the attributes specified by this anyAttribute element. It is used to extend a complexType element defined in one xsd by an attribute which is not defined in the schema. By using the <anyAttribute> element we can add any number of attributes to the "person" element: XSD Group, AttributeGroup, Any and AnyAttribute This article covers some of the less frequently used constructs in the XML Schema Standard. <xs:anyAttribute> element is used to extend the XSD functionality. The <anyAttribute> Element The <anyAttribute> element enables us to extend the XML document with attributes not specified by the schema. . xsd Type: Anonymous Properties: You can create it by dragging the 'Any Attribute' icon from the XML Schema Toolbox and dropping it onto an «XSDcomplexType» or «XSDattributeGroup» stereotyped Class. If no processContents attribute is specified, the default is strict. bwzi, vsofvi, hedcc, 7vxsv, htq, cbiy8l0z7, y6, t8dt, jtggm9v, sg1zt,